The manuscript "Enhancement of nutritional substance, trace elements, and pigments in waxy maize grains through foliar application of selenite"reflects an extensive and detailed work to obtain information on the effects of foliar application with Selenium in waxy corn.

There is only one aspect that deserves to be clarified and it has to do with the experimental design, the authors in line 126 say that the applications were repeated thrice, but it is not clear if it was 3 different plots randomly assigned in which the treatment was repeated. It is also not explicit whether these samples then constituted each of the triplicates or whether they were pooled to make a single sample.

Minors:

It is recommended that waxy corn be defined the first time it is mentioned in the introduction.

It is not possible to know from Table 1 whether the differences are significant.

The paper “Enhancement of nutritional substance, trace elements, and pigments in waxy maize grains through foliar application of selenite” reports on the main findings of a two-year study on the application of Se to two different varieties of waxy maize, i.e., J20 and C1965., by foliar spraying The effect in terms of nutritional quality (Soluble Sugar and Sucrose Content, Starch Content, protein, fat, lysine content) is studied. The effect on the functional quality of waxy maize grains is also investigated (anthocyanins and carotenoids).

We hypothesized that foliar spraying of Se can enhance the Se content of waxy maize grains, stimulate the synthesis and absorption of other trace elements, and elicit secondary effects of increasing nutritional substance and pigment content, thereby effectively improving the quality of maize grains.
